This session We are going to Look into the RCA 77 series of ribbon mics commencing With all the really very first design, the 77A.

There was Yet another screwdriver activate the really bottom on the mic physique that selected minimal frequency or “bass” equalization. This allowed the mic for use for shut talking without a “muddy” or “boomy” result to get a cleaner sound transmission. All ribbon mics are likely to emphasize the bass when made use of close up. This was a big revolution in mic structure and designed it probable to beat a lot of microphone sound get challenges like imperfect acoustics leading to a more info lot of reverberation and sound in rooms and studios. It's also a fantastic help in general public tackle programs by lowering the inclination to “feed back” or “howl.”

NBC was owned by RCA again in that point And they'd only use RCA mics as well as other gear made by RCA. The long succession of Tonight demonstrate hosts had an RCA 77DX about the desk For a long time even towards the early yrs of Johnny Carson.

They have been also made use of on ground stands in radio and television studios. for those who view the reruns on the previous Lawrence Welk Television set exhibits through the ’50s you’ll notice that ABC utilised the RCA 77D mics, generally two before the sax part and two much more in back again to pick up the trumpets and trombones. Later while in the ’60s ABC audio engineers modified towards the Electro-Voice design 666 cardioid dynamics with the Welk orchestra pickup.

once the war finished, Olson went back to engaged on his investigate in audio replica. He famously executed an experiment that could identify the popular bandwidth for reproduced audio. in advance of this experiment, scientific studies had demonstrated that listeners favored a superior frequency cutoff of five kHz.

Harry F. Olson is most likely an unfamiliar title, but I’m confident you’ve heard of one of the a hundred additionally innovations Olson has patented. His patents incorporate the cardioid microphone, audio absorbers, and the first programmable audio synthesizer. He was straight chargeable for the RCA forty four and RCA seventy seven ribbon microphones.

77D and 77DX past inside the sequence–both of those appeared generally a similar. In TV creation the RCA 77 with it’s broad front facet pickup pattern was great for overhead boom use; it turned down studio noises in the back from the mic like digital camera as well as other track record noises. In radio and TV the RCA 77 sequence, Primarily the later on designs, 77D and 77DX, ended up extremely popular. RCA experienced a beautifully designed art deco model desk stand for these mics.

The RCA kind seventy seven-D Polydirectional Microphone is actually a substantial-fidelity microphone with the ribbon type. It can be done, as indicated from the title, to acquire very easily many different directional styles.

The ribbon is positioned In the housing in such a way that "p" Appears (plosives) may possibly induce popping Seems, mainly because of the explosion of air right in the ribbon.
